Guest lenwadebob Posted October 21, 2009 Report Posted October 21, 2009 WOOD PRESERVATIVE CUPRINOL TRADE LANDSCAPE STAIN AND PRESERVER HSE 8573 THE APPROVAL Marketing Company IMPERIAL CHEMICAL INDUSTRIES PLC Active Ingredient PROPICONAZOLE - 0.6% w/w 3-IODO-2-PROPYNYL-N-BUTYL CARBAMATE - 0.4% w/w Formulation WATER BASED READY-FOR-USE THE CONDITIONS Application Method BRUSH, DIP OR SPRAY Container 2.5 LITRE, 5 LITRE, AND 20 LITRE. USE Field of Use FOR USE ONLY AS A WOOD PRESERVATIVE User AMATEUR PROFESSIONAL Application Rate BRUSH/SPRAY: APPLY 1 LITRE OF PRODUCT PER 4-8 SQUARE METRE OF TIMBER SURFACE. DIP: DIP TIMBER FOR 3-10 MINUTES. Page 31 of 38 PRECAUTIONARY PHRASES AMATEUR LABEL OP Wear suitable protective clothing and suitable gloves. OP Do not breathe gas/fumes/vapour/spray (appropriate wording to be specified by the manufacturer). OP Otherwise wear respiratory protective equipment and eye protection (See HSE Guidance Booklet HS (G) 53: "The Selection, Use and Maintenance of Respiratory Protective Equipment - A Practical Guide"). EN DO NOT CONTAMINATE FOODSTUFFS, EATING UTENSILS OR FOOD CONTACT SURFACES. EN COVER ALL WATER STORAGE TANKS before application. EN This material and its container must be disposed of in a safe way. EN Do not empty into drains RE UNPROTECTED PERSONS AND ANIMALS SHOULD BE KEPT AWAY FROM TREATED AREAS FOR 48 HOURS OR UNTIL SURFACES ARE DRY. EP Do not contaminate ground, waterbodies or watercourses with chemicals or used container. RE FOR OUTDOOR USE ONLY. EN ALL BATS ARE PROTECTED UNDER THE WILDLIFE AND COUNTRYSIDE ACT 1981. BEFORE TREATING ANY STRUCTURE USED BY BATS, CONSULT NATURAL ENGLAND, SCOTTISH NATURAL HERITAGE OR THE COUNTRYSIDE COUNCIL FOR WALES. PROFESSIONAL LABEL US FOR USE ONLY BY PROFESSIONAL OPERATORS.
